Delta Airlines Ticket Refund

Delta Airlines Ticket Refund?
So I booked a $773.98 ticket through Delta for my girlfriend to fly round trip to Canada from Memphis to pick up her dog. We spoke with 2 different representatives at Delta to make sure the 105 pound dog would be permitted to fly once before the flight was booked and again after the flight was booked. Once in Canada my girlfriend called for a third time to make sure everything was in place for him to fly home. NOPE!!!!!!!!! They said the dog weighed too much and that there was a 100 pound weight limit. They even have on file for her ticket that she would be returning with a 105 pound dog. The corporate office was very very rude in resolving the conflict. The ticket was purchased on false information given by delta. They say that there was nothing they could do. We have spent many many hours on the phone. My Girlfriend ended up "getting the return flight reimbursed" before her return trip. Then we just called up Delta to check on the status of the claim. Denied!!!!!! Because she flew the return trip. The ladies at corporate straight up lied, and are now denying that they said they would reimburse us for the return trip. It was made clear on the phone that the return flight was being reimbursed for her inconvenience with the knowledge that she would be actually flying that flight home. Any ideas?

If you have a local consumer affairs advocate where you live (they are usually affiliated with a TV station), contact them. Or Small Claims Court.

There's not much you can do. As the consumer, you are ultimately responsible with adhereing to the airlines rules. Their rules are available to the public on their website.
4 :
You can write and complain and the more detail you have the better. Write down the day and time you called and the representative's names of whom you spoke to. That would hopefully strengthen your case. However Delta can deny just as AJ mentioned because they do have rules and it is up to the passenger to adhere to the rules. If you are lucky, you may be able to get a small travel voucher. One time I flew with Delta and they broke the wheels off my luggage and would only give me a $25 travel voucher.
